Six Ways to Celebrate Mardi Gras in the Red Stick.
The Big Easy isn’t the only place that celebrates Carnival season in a big way. The good times roll in Baton Rouge before Fat Tuesday with six parades (three daytime parades and three at night).
Get your costume together (or at least don purple, green and gold) and celebrate this wonderful Louisiana tradition in an atmosphere perfect for the whole family. Glittering floats, Carnival royalty, snazzy marching bands, throws, throws, throws! Come experience it all in the State Capital.

2018 Baton Rouge Mardi Gras Parade Schedule

What: Krewe of Orion
Where: Downtown
When: Saturday, January 27, 6:30 p.m.
What: Krewe of Mutts
Where: Downtown
When: Sunday, January 28, 10:30 a.m.
What: Krewe of Artemis Parade
Where: Downtown
When: Friday, February 2, 7 p.m.
What: Krewe of Mystique
Where: Downtown
When: Saturday, February 3, 2 p.m.
What: Krewe of Southdowns
Where: Southdowns Neighborhood - Glasgow Middle School
When: Friday, February 9, 7 p.m.
What: Krewe of Spanish Town Parade
Where: Downtown
When: Saturday, February 10, noon
